                  Result of Inspection.

                  It seems

                  • Turtle’s Calendar - Personal Public calendars
                  • Other 3 Calendars - Has only access allowed to Your G Suite Group.

                  In this case; the other 3 Calendars’ ical addresses will not be accessible from externs.

                  For example; Open the browser and put the URL of your “Work calendar” in the address form. It will show 404 error
                  In your Google Calendar settings, you can see warns.

                  Warning: The address won’t work unless this calendar is public.
